Calcium (urine)
Calcium (urine) | |
CALU, 24CAL | |
Random urine sample in 20ml universal, 24hr urine collection in plain (non-acidified) bottle | |
72hrs | |
Used in the investigation of renal stone formation (calculi) and in the investigation of hyper- and hypocalcaemia | |
No known interferences | |
Random urine calcium: A reference interval for this test result has not been provided because individual factors, such as medications, diet, and other health conditions, may significantly affect the interpretation of the results. For further discussion, please contact the Consultant Chemical Pathologist.
24hr excretion 2.5-7.5mmol/24hr |
